I have managed to install vista twice how do I uninstall both?

August 16th, 2009 · 1 Comment

Bought a Fujitsu Siemens Amilo: Intel CPU T2060 @ 1.60Ghz; RAM 766 MB; 32 Bit OS. Installed Vista Home Basic after a few months started crashing regularly. Followed all the net tutorials to no avail. Last resort reinstalled Vista, most of the problems gone. But realized I’d left the old os in place thus restricting memory. Please very clear step by step instructions. Want to uninstall both as I find WMP 11 a nightmare won’t read majority of my dvds

      Unless you created a partition on your hard drive, or you have multiple hard drives in your system, it’s not possible to install more than one operating system. If you did create a partition, or you have multiple hard drives, then you can delete the operating system by doing this:

      1. Click the start button
      2. Right-click ‘computer’ and select manage
      3. Go to disk management
      4. Format or delete the partition or hard drive with the operating (this will delete everything on that partition or hard drive, so transfer anything you need to the other partition or hard drive first)

      EDIT: To uninstall both, just do this to both partitions/hard drives. This will delete everything on your computer, though, and will leave you without an operating system, so make sure you have install discs for another operating system before you do this.
